Detection Capability Enhanced Biosensor Antenna for Portable Electromagnetic Stroke Diagnostic Systems.

Hui Chen, Kwai-Man Luk

    IEEE Transactions on Biomedical Circuits and Systems
    |September 11, 2023
    PubMed
    Summary

    This study introduces an enhanced biosensor antenna for portable electromagnetic (EM) stroke detection. The novel design improves early stroke diagnosis by enabling the detection of smaller affected areas.

    Area of Science:

    • Biomedical Engineering
    • Electromagnetics
    • Medical Diagnostics

    Background:

    • Portable electromagnetic (EM) systems are crucial for early stroke detection and patient monitoring.
    • Biosensor antennas are key hardware components in these EM diagnostic systems.
    • Existing designs face limitations in detection capability for stroke diagnosis.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To present a detect capability-enhanced biosensor antenna for portable EM stroke detection systems.
    • To overcome the limited detection capability of current designs.
    • To improve early on-site stroke detection and long-term monitoring.

    Main Methods:

    • Development of a compact, planar biosensor antenna based on multiple dipoles.
    • Utilizing multi-mode resonances and complementary interaction for enhanced performance.
    • Simulation and measurement using head phantoms and a 12-element antenna array.

    Main Results:

    • The proposed antenna shows improved impedance bandwidth and near-field radiation within head tissues.
    • Successful detection of stroke-affected areas as small as 3 mm in radius was achieved.
    • Enhanced stroke detection capability was validated in a lab-setting EM stroke diagnostic system.

    Conclusions:

    • The developed compact planar biosensor antenna significantly enhances stroke detection capability.
    • This advancement is critical for improving radar-based EM diagnosis of stroke.
    • The antenna design offers a promising solution for portable and effective stroke diagnostic systems.
